NOTICE: Replace condenser if necessary referring to condenser replacement procedure, Section 1B, Page 1B-43 of the 1989 "B" Carline Service manual.

1. Inspect for previously installed, new style, compressor discharge hose/pipe assembly. Illustrations of old and new style compressor discharge hose/pipe assemblies are shown on page 5. If the compressor discharge hose/pipe assembly has been previously replaced with the new style compressor discharge hose/pipe assembly, install Campaign Identification Label and return the vehicle to the owner or dealer stock. If the compressor discharge hose/pipe assembly has not been previously replaced with the new style hose/pipe, proceed with steps 2 through 14 below.

2. Disconnect both battery cables at battery.

3. Remove battery hold-down and remove battery.

4. Remove upper half of fan shroud.

NOTICE: Carefully wedge small section of 2X4 between the top portions of the radiator and A/C condenser for work clearance.

5. Remove the two (2) 8 mm screw/bolts that hold the condenser bracket to condenser.

6. Remove two (2) 7 mm screw/bolts holding the inlet and outlet tube clamps to the condenser bracket. Leave clamps on tubes and save two (2) 7 mm screw/bolts. Remove condenser bracket.

7. Install new condenser bracket (from kit) on condenser using two
(2) new 8mm screw/bolts (from kit) and torque to 2.8 - 3.4 N-m (24.8 - 30.1 in.lbs.). DO NOT OVERTOROUE.



NOTICE: Figure # 1 on page 6 illustrates the installation of the condenser bracket kit. This figure may be helpful in performing steps 6 - 10 of this procedure.

8. Install new clamp (from kit) over upper inlet tube (flat side of clip should face new condenser bracket). Slide clamp forward on tube until hole in clamp lines up with forward hole in condenser bracket and secure clamp with new 7 mm screw/bolt (from kit). Torque 2.3 - 2.8 N-m (20.4 - 24.8 lbs. in.). DO NOT OVERTORQUE.

NOTICE: Tubes may have to be moved or shifted to get holes in clamps to line up with holes in condenser bracket.

9. Secure existing clamp on upper inlet tube to upper hole at end of condenser bracket with a 7 mm screw/bolt (removed previously) and torque to 2.3 - 2.8 N-m (20.4 - 24.8 in.lbs.). DO NOT OVERTOROUE.
10. Secure existing clamp on lower outlet tube to lower hole at end of condenser bracket with a 7 mm screw/bolt (removed previously) and torque to 2.3 - 2.8 N-m (20.4 -24.8 in.lbs.). DO NOT OVERTOROUE.

NOTICE: Make sure lower outlet tube does not contact or rub bottom of new condenser bracket. If tube does contact or rub bracket, bend tube away from condenser bracket.

11. Remove 2x4 and reinstall upper half of fan shroud.

12. Reinstall battery and battery hold down.

13. Reconnect battery cables.

14. Install Campaign identification Label.
